1.

FLASHCARD QUESTION

Front

What does SSS stand for in triangle congruence?

Back

SSS stands for Side-Side-Side, a theorem stating that if three sides of one triangle are equal to three sides of another triangle, then the triangles are congruent.

2.

FLASHCARD QUESTION

Front

What does SAS stand for in triangle congruence?

Back

SAS stands for Side-Angle-Side, a theorem stating that if two sides and the included angle of one triangle are equal to two sides and the included angle of another triangle, then the triangles are congruent.

3.

FLASHCARD QUESTION

Front

What is the importance of the order of vertices in triangle congruence?

Back

The order of vertices is important because it indicates which angles and sides correspond to each other in congruent triangles.

4.

FLASHCARD QUESTION

Front

Can two triangles be congruent if only one side is known?

Back

No, knowing only one side is not enough to prove triangle congruence; additional information about angles or other sides is needed.

5.

FLASHCARD QUESTION

Front

If two triangles have two pairs of equal sides and the included angle is also equal, what can be concluded?

Back

The triangles are congruent by the SAS theorem.

6.

FLASHCARD QUESTION

Front

What is the definition of congruent triangles?

Back

Congruent triangles are triangles that are identical in shape and size, meaning all corresponding sides and angles are equal.

7.

FLASHCARD QUESTION

Front

How can you prove that two triangles are congruent using the SSS theorem?

Back

To prove congruence using SSS, show that all three sides of one triangle are equal to the three sides of another triangle.
